Rationale

Signal Recognition is a highly multi-disciplinary topic which is not covered in whole by any one course. This course describes commonalities among many real-world signal recognition and classification problems stemming from sources such as human biometrics, imaging, geophysics, machinery, electronics, genetics, networking, chemical plants, languages, communications, finance, etc. It introduces tools and algorithms derived from many different engineering disciplines to be able to fully address practical recognition and classification problems. The course is appropriate for graduate students in all engineering disciplines.
